How's this for S T R E T C H I N G the size of your ice cream cone? It was easy to do ....
1. Create your card base (see beginner basics) with Tempting Turquoise card
stock.
2. Make a Whisper white card stock layer with TOP NOTE DIE and the BIG
SHOT MACHINE.
3. Cut a Pink Piroutte card stock layer that is 1" x 3 3/4". Apply to white layer
and trim off around the curved areas.
4. Stamp the sentiment Wish Big in Melon Mambo ink on white card stock and
punch out with a 3/4" circle punch. Layer that on top of a Pretty in Pink and a
Crumb Cake panel that are punched out using the Small Oval Punch.
5. To make the ice cream cone use the Pennant Parade stamp set for the cone
base. Stamp Crumb Cake Ink on Crumb Cake paper and punch out using the
Pennant Builder punch.
6. Each of the ice cream layers are made with the CUPCAKE BUILDER punch.
Card stock colors are Pool Party, Pretty in Pink and Daffodil Delight and
topped with a cherry of Melon Mambo.
7. Sparkle up your ice cream layers by squeezing liquid DAZZLING DETAILS on
the tops.
